X' a boy of eleven years stabbed his father thrice as he saw that his two elder brother stabbed the father one after the other he ran away. On being questioned, 'X' justified his act saying that his two elder brothers would not have stabbed the father unless he had done "something wrong" and hence deserved to be killed. What is the criminal liability of 'X' in the case?

A. X should be convicted under Section 302, Indian Penal Code for murder

B. X should be convicted under Section 304, Indian Penal Code for culpable homicide

C. X should be acquitted as he had not attained sufficient maturity of understanding to judge the nature and consequences of his conduct

D. X should be acquitted under Section 82, Indian Penal Code as infancy as a defence as one of the general exception to criminal liability

Answer: Option C
